OSTEO-ARTHRITIS IN FINGERS
Hi All, I have just registered with the group so this is my first post. I have osteo-arthritis in my knees; one has been replaced (and the other will need to be replaced in due course). But at least something can be done about knees and hips. Fingers are rather different. As far as I've been able to find out, there's no real track record of successful joint replacement. Mine are painful and stiff - and they're getting less flexible by the week. I can't now close one hand (so it's difficult, for example to hold a pen and it hurts to pick things up and grip is non-existent) and the other hand is steadily following suit. I already do a range of "recommended" exercises but they aren't stopping the relentless deterioration in movement. Does anyone else have similar problems?
